This beautiful Eldorado home is filled with the furnishings and collections of an artist/weaver/crafter and her husband, who have downsized to a new home in town. The sale includes great vintage MCM furniture as well as many newer pieces, lots of weavings - Navajo, Oaxacan and a spectacular Peter Collingwood rug, Native American and folk art collectibles, jewelry, books and cameras, clothing and accessories, and lots of good household and garden items.

FURNISHINGS: a 1960S Illums Bolighus Copenhagen dining set, a 1960s Johanne Sorth for Bornholm Brazilian rosewood secretary, a 1960s Dux teak coffee table and side table, Southwest Style sideboards and cabinet, a Natuzzi leather sofa, and 2 leather armchairs, a  Wilding murphy bed and storage cabinet
